Vanity Plates in Florida: How to Get One
Want a distinctive way to express yourself on Florida’s roads? Acquiring vanity plates – officially known as personalized license tags – is surprisingly straightforward. First, you'll need to visit the Florida Department of Highway Safety and Motor Vehicles (FLHSMV) website or go to a local copyright service center. Then, check that your desired plate combination isn’t already in use – the online system provides instant feedback on availability. Next, submit an application and pay a non-refundable processing fee; this typically includes an initial fee plus annual charges. Your proposed plate text must adhere to specific rules regarding length (generally eight characters or less) and content – it can't be offensive or misleading. After approval, you’ll receive new registration documents and your personalized tag will be manufactured and mailed to you within several weeks, ready for display on your vehicle.
The Symbolism Behind Florida's License Plate Design
Florida’s unique license tag is more than just a method of identification; it's a carefully developed visual story rich with state symbolism. The iconic orange, representing the state’s crucial citrus business , is prominently shown , alongside a stylized depiction of palmetto trees, which are deeply rooted to Florida's heritage. Furthermore, the sunshine motif, a universally recognized emblem of the state’s sunny climate and vibrant lifestyle, rounds out the design. This thoughtful arrangement aims to convey a sense of Florida’s natural beauty and its economic foundations to residents and visitors alike .
